Программируемые логические контроллеры Программируемый логический контроллер — это микропроцессорное устройство. Предназначено для сбора, обработки, процессов преобразования, а также хранения информационных данных. Дополнительно вырабатывает команды управления. В конструктивном плане включает несколько входов и выходов, к которым подключаются датчики, ключи и исполнительные механизмы. Прибор используют в режиме реального времени. Сегодня многие интересуются PLC, что это значит, так как такие устройства необходимы для реализации современных схем управления различными процессами промышленного типа. Принцип работы ПЛК — это определение, которое часто дают в различной технической документации разного назначения. Но при этом важно сразу отметить, что принцип функционирования в данном случае отличается от работы стандартных микропроцессорных приборов. Программное обеспечение (ПО) контроллеров универсального назначения включает в себя два компонента. Первым является системное программное обеспечение (аналог операционной системы компьютера) находится в центральном процессоре внутри постоянной памяти, всегда находится в состоянии готовности начать работать. Это означает, что любой программируемый логический контроллер в состоянии сразу после включения питания в течение нескольких миллисекунд стартовать функционировать. ПЛК — это контроллер, который выполняет работу с помощью обхода данных путем последовательного опроса. Каждый из рабочих циклов является четырехфазным. Перечислим: первоначальный опрос входов; реализация программы пользователя (исполнение); на выходах регистрируются конкретные значения; далее производятся операции вспомогательного характера. К ним могут относится визуализация, диагностические работы, подбор данных для дальнейшей отладки и т. д. Начальная фаза реализуется за счет системной программы. После этой процедуры управление идет через прикладную программу, которая была ранее записана пользователем в память устройства. По завершении операций, указанной в ней, управление ведется снова на системном уровне. Типичный ПЛК состоит из следующих частей: Через входы к блоку управления подключаются, например, кнопки, световые барьеры или датчики температуры. Благодаря этим компонентам система ПЛК может отслеживать текущее состояние машины. Выходы подключены к устройству, например, к электродвигателям, гидравлическим клапанам, которые ПЛК использует для управления конкретной машиной. Программа пользователя - программное обеспечение для ПЛК, обеспечивает переключение выходов в зависимости от активации входов. Коммуникационный интерфейс используется для подключения ПЛК к другим системам. ПЛК также включает в себя собственный источник питания, центральный процессор и внутреннюю шину. Удобство системы заключается в простоте построения структуры самой программы, так как создателю не обязательно иметь информацию об управлении ресурсами аппаратного формата. Но при этом понимание, с какого из выходов передается сигнал, а какая реакция должна присутствовать на выходах, должно быть. Так как программный логистический контроллер обладает памятью, он способен на текущие события реагировать разным образом. Поэтому в сравнении с обычными комбинационными аппаратами имеет ряд преимуществ: возможность перепрограммирования; широко развитые способности вычислений; цифровая обработка сигналов. Классификация ПЛК по видам Все программируемые логические контроллеры делятся на несколько видов: основного типа; программируемое реле (интеллектуальное); на базе IBM PC совместимых компьютеров (частая расшифровка — SoftPLC); на базе микропроцессоров простейшего типа; контроллеры электронной системы управления двигателем (ЭСУД). PLC на базе персонального компьютера в последние годы получил широкое распространение и активно развивается. Такое положение дел вызвано следующими причинами: повышение степени надежности персональных компьютеров; появление новых модификаций для обычного и промышленного исполнения; наличие открытой архитектуры; подключение широкого перечня модулей УСО, выпускаемых сторонними производителями; обширная номенклатура с уже разработанным программным обеспечением. Структурные особенности PLC Моноблочные ПЛК — это устройства, которые включают несколько видов входов и выходов. Для пояснения проще всего рассмотреть их особенности. Всего существует 3 вида входов: дискретные. Каждый из таких входов может принимать 1 электрический сигнал бинарного типа. Описывается двумя состояниями: включением или выключением. Большинство входов изначально рассчитаны для приема сигналов с постоянным током на 24 В. Поэтому сам ток равен в данном случае 10 мА; аналоговый сигнал отвечает за отражение уровня тока или напряжения, которые соответствуют определенной физической величине в определенный временной момент. Этими показателями могут быть, например, значение скорости, веса, температуры, давления, частоты и т. д. Такой формат сигнала всегда подвергается АЦП. Поэтому на выходе получается дискретная переменная с некой разрядностью. Сами модули такого ввода относятся к многоканальным; наиболее распространенный тип входов — специализированный счетный, который предназначен, чтобы производить измерения фиксации и длительности фронтов, а также подсчета импульсов. Дискретный выход устроен идентичным образом и тоже имеет два основных состояния. Может быть включенным или выключенным. Применяются для управления такими конструктивными элементами как электромагнитные клапаны, катушки, пускатели, световые сигнализаторы и многие другие. То есть сферы применения очень разнообразны и широки. Крайне важно рассмотреть структуры систем управления всех ПЛК контроллеров. Встречаются двух видов: 1. централизованная подразумевает установку модулей процессоров, вводов и выводов, связующих звеньев в объединительную панель, называемую часто корзиной. Для расширения последней устанавливаются модули расширения, которые масштабируют пределы одного блока. Подключение исполнительных устройств и датчиков происходит при помощи проводов к модулям со входами и выходами; 2. распределенная означает отдельные и удаленные с PLC датчики от основного блока и исполнительные устройства. Связь осуществляется за счет наличия каналов связи (специальные модули и процессоры). Иногда в схему добавляются корзины-расширители, изготовленные по принципу связей ведущих и ведомых элементов.